ABOUT FIU
Florida International University is recognized as a Carnegie engaged university. It is a public research university with colleges and schools that offers more than 180 bachelor’s, master’s and doctoral programs in fields such as engineering, international relations, architecture, law and medicine. As one of South Florida’s anchor institutions, FIU contributes $9.8 billion each year to the local economy. FIU is Worlds Ahead in finding solutions to the most challenging problems of our time. FIU emphasizes research as a major component of its mission. FIU has awarded over 200,000 degrees and enrolls more than 54,000 students in two campuses and three centers including FIU Downtown on Brickell, FIU @ I-75, and the Miami Beach Urban Studios. FIU also supports artistic and cultural engagement through its three museums: the Patricia & Phillip Frost Art Museum, the Wolfsonian-FIU, and the Jewish Museum of Florida-FIU. FIU is a member of Conference USA and has over 400 student-athletes participating in 18 sports. For more information about FIU, visit http://www.fiu.edu/.
POSITION DESCRIPTION
he Herbert Wertheim College of Medicine is currently seeking a Social Media Manager to join our team of professionals.
Duties Include:
- Leads the creation, implementation, and optimization of the social media strategy. Sets goals, benchmarks and objectives for content and social channel performance. Collaborates with HWCOM units and stakeholders to support unit goals and needs.
- Oversees Herbert Wertheim College of Medicine (HWCOM) and other college sanctioned media accounts. Identifies emerging social media trends and networks and ideates on how HWCOM can best leverage these.
- Collaborates with HWCOM unit liaisons to develop social media communication campaigns and strategies for strategic initiatives that drive university-wide goals.
- Analyses and interprets media/communication administrative rules and policies to effectively manage educational media/communication administration. Implements and watches for social media policy compliance across HWCOM platforms.
- Measures impact of social media on overall marketing efforts and evaluates results. Assists in the creation of social media performance reports and analysis for paid and organic content.
- Analyzes qualitative data from first-party sources in order to gather findings and actionable insights in order to make recommendations to optimize social media strategies.
- Uses social media listening strategies and tools to monitor social conversations that impact HWCOM. Monitors conversations and trends that might grow into crises and reports to key stakeholders.
- Engages with audiences using the established University tone in order to have a consistent voice across all HWCOM social channels.
- Monitors comments and assists with questions in posted content and direct communication channels (inbox management).
- Identifies trends and conversations both inside and outside HWCOM that provides opportunity for interaction. Assists in the cultivation of partnerships with social media influencers.
- Assists in developing strategies for brand management, reputation management, including managing comments on digital channels under the supervision of the Director of Media and Community Relations.
- Coordinates with the central brand marketing team and the HWCOM marketing office to develop breakthrough content campaigns that accelerate social performance.
- Works hand in hand with the central Multimedia team and the HWCOM marketing office to brainstorm and develop content. Establishes content priorities and plans accordingly.
- Provides management and curation of social media content for all HWCOM flagship accounts.
- Oversees the editorial, creative and approval management of all social media content and messages under the direction of the HWCOM Director of Media and Community Relations. Identifies best publishing times and schedules content to achieve best results.
